Carolyn M. Sheppard is a scholar working on Ceramics and Composites, Mechanics of Materials and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Carolyn M. Sheppard has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 461 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Ceramics and Composites, 7 papers in Mechanics of Materials and 6 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Carolyn M. Sheppard’s work include Advanced ceramic materials synthesis (9 papers), Hydrocarbon exploration and reservoir analysis (6 papers) and Petroleum Processing and Analysis (5 papers). Carolyn M. Sheppard is often cited by papers focused on Advanced ceramic materials synthesis (9 papers), Hydrocarbon exploration and reservoir analysis (6 papers) and Petroleum Processing and Analysis (5 papers). Carolyn M. Sheppard collaborates with scholars based in New Zealand, Japan and United States. Carolyn M. Sheppard's co-authors include Roderick J. Weston, Anthony D. Woolhouse, Kenneth J.D. MacKenzie, R. Paul Philp, R.H. Meinhold, T.D. Gilbert, G. V. White, Barbara L. Sherriff, Richard A. Cook and Shiro Shimada and has published in prestigious journals such as Geochimica et Cosmochimica Acta, Journal of Materials Science and Energy & Fuels.
